Rinker School Spring Career Fair Aiding in 100 Percent Job Placement

The M.E. Rinker, Sr. School of Construction Management at UF held its Spring Career Fair on February 21, 2018. Nearly 300 UF students were able to visit with the 95 companies in attendance.

The Rinker School is known as one of the only schools at the University of Florida that has 100 percent job placement for its students after graduation. The career fair each semester is a large part of that success.

“Our school has continued to excel with the support of the alumni and industry,” said Dr. Raymond Issa, Interim Director of Rinker. “The Rinker School Career Fair is an outstanding opportunity to bring together industry and our students.”

The Stephen C. O’Connell Center was buzzing with energy during the career fair with plenty of students and employers excited to network and meet one another.

“Even though you might have an internship lined up already, you get to meet different people and different companies,” said Luckso Joacius, an S1 student at the Rinker School.

This spring career fair was Joacius’ fourth career fair as a student.

“You never know where you’re going to end up at, so it’s always good to meet new people,” Joacius said.

Maggie Drotos, alumni liaison and marketing and communication specialist for the Rinker School, led the charge in planning and organizing the spring career fair.

“The Rinker School started the Career Fairs in 1989, and we are proud of the continued success over the years,” Drotos said.
